Red Sox Beat Sloppy Astros 6-1 Behind Lucas Giolito's Stellar Start

SUFFOLK COUNTY, MASSACHUSETTS, AUG 3 – The Red Sox seek a series sweep at Fenway, with Lucas Giolito starting despite a 2-6 record against the Astros, who aim to avoid their first road sweep this season.

  • Attempting a series sweep, Boston sends Lucas Giolito to start Sunday as the Red Sox aim to beat the 62-49 Astros at Fenway Park.
  • After wins Friday and Saturday, Boston Red Sox aim for the sweep as they have won 4 straight and 6 of 7.
  • Despite Boston's 11-of-12 home-game surge, Giolito is 2-6 with a 5.94 ERA in nine starts against Houston at Fenway Park.
  • After losing the first 2 games and having lost 7 of their last 9, the Astros hope to avoid a series sweep on Sunday.
  • To maintain rotation order, Boston shifted Dustin May’s debut from Sunday to Wednesday, and Alex Cora said the change preserves Giolito’s regular spot.

BOSTON (AP) — Trevor Story and Ceddanne Rafaela hit consecutive RBI singles in a six-run fourth inning plagued by five errors by Houston, and Lucas Giolito pitched eight innings as the Boston Red Sox beat the Astros 6-1 on Sunday for a series sweep. Connor Wong added a sacrifice fly and Wilyer Abreu was credited with an RBI on a safety squeeze in the fourth.
